A two year old girl was likely kicked or stamped to death. Murder trial is underway and expected to last 6 to 8 weeks.

This is a very sad case, the little girl was found because a woman received a Facebook message from “a friend of hers” (the mum) saying she had died in her sleep three days before and was in her pushchair in the bathroom. Police then attended and found the body.


 

Jurors heard in a subsequent conversation between the pair, Gleason-Mitchell "told me that Isabella was dead".

In a message read to the court, Gleason-Mitchell said: "We can't call police as she developed bruises, and we will get done for it."

[...]

Gleason-Mitchell sent a series of voice notes, with one saying: "We literally can't go to the police because she's covered in bruises."

In a further message, Gleason-Mitchell told Miss Gardner: "I feel like we're just going to bury her and hope for the best."

Miss Gardner said Gleason-Mitchell asked her to delete the messages and gave the "impression the police were there".
